1. GoSports

GoSports is an excellent cornhole brand for every skill level, price range, and occasion, and it is one of the fastest-growing outdoor sports brands in the country. Its most popular model, the solid wood premium cornhole set, is a professional grade board at $128, one of the most affordable prices on the market for such a high-end quality. As a professional style board, it is a sturdy 38 pounds due to regulatory requirements, but it's foldable legs make it easier to transport and set up. Most GoSports boards use premium varnished pinewood, and available designs include simple wood, sophisticated digital prints, as well as fun and affordable children’s options with popular cartoon characters. A full set of regulation bags come included with most boards, as well as a carrying case and a small tote for the boards and beanbags.

2. American Cornhole Association

The American Cornhole Association is the primary standard-setter for all cornhole rules and regulations, so consumers can trust that its products are among the best and up to regulation standards. The ACA’s boards are perfect for anyone who is serious about developing their skillset or playing professionally, though they also sell some travel-sized and recreational options. Both regulation two by four-foot boards and tailgate two by three-foot boards are made of grade A plywood, with options including mahogany, birchwood, and Okoume, all of which are available in either simple polished or digitally printed designs. Its regulation cornhole bags come in sets of both ordinary competition-style at $15 or in a high-grade professional style at $50, the latter of which has special microfibers to strategically grip and slide across the board. Casual recreational boards are more lightweight and sell at around $150 or more, and weightier professional boards generally sell at $300 or more. 

3. Victory Tailgate

Victory Tailgate is one of the most popular and beloved mid-luxury cornhole brands for its high-quality custom designs, which come in the widest variety available on the market. Both board sets and optional accessories can be purchased in themes of any professional league sports team encompassed by major league soccer, the NFL, the NBA, the NHL, and the MLB, as well as any NCAA recognized college team. They also have a variety of summery graphic designs and American flag boards available or customizable boards in either two by four or two by three-foot sizes, which you can have specially made with your own graphic design. It’s not just the designs, but the boards themselves, which are high quality, with durable cabinet-grade hardwood and triple stitched duck cloth bags. The boards sell for around $250 to $300, slightly on the more expensive end but also a good value for premium ACA standard boards.

5. Himal

Himal cornhole products may not be your standard regulation set, but for the purpose of a simple just-for-fun game (in an outdoor environment especially), they are some of the most convenient and inexpensive options on the market. Unlike standard wooden boards, Himal’s most well-known $37 cornhole sets have an anti-skid fabric base set over a high elastic flat wire. They are two by three-foot measurement boards, which are put away by folding and set up by allowing the wire to spring the board back into place. Each board is folded down to 11 inches by 11 inches and stacked on top of each other to fit into an easily portable carrying case that comes included, along with eight complimentary cornhole bags. Himal’s portable cornhole sets are easily some of the best for activities like camping or a beach day, as they don’t burden the carrier with excess weight or volume.
